Very Scarce Vintage (1910-1930) US Poster Stamp Pennsylvania Board of Fish Commissioners "If You Would Catch More Fish...Kill Less MNHThis Uniquely Shaped Poster Stamp—Die-Cut In The Form Of A Fish—Was Issued By The Pennsylvania Board Of Fish Commissioners As Part Of A Conservation Campaign Promoting Responsible Angling. The Bold Slogan Across The Center Reads: “If You Would Catch More Fish, Kill Less!”, A Direct And Memorable Message Encouraging Fishermen To Practice Restraint In Harvesting To Ensure Sustainable Fish Populations. The Stamp Uses Gold And Black Printing On A Tan Background, With Emphasis Placed On The Word “Kill Less!” In Large Script. Below The Central Message, The Attribution “Penna. Board Of Fish Commissioners” Confirms Its Governmental Origin. Likely Produced Between The 1910s And 1930s—A Period When Conservation Messaging Became Increasingly Common In North American Fish And Wildlife Policy—This Stamp Would Have Been Distributed To Sportsmen, Fishing Clubs, Or Posted In Tackle Shops And License Offices As A Form Of Visual Outreach. Its Engaging Shape, Eye-Catching Design, And Public Service Message Make It A Notable Example Of Early American Environmental Awareness In Ephemera Form.
